uropean Parliament adopts resolution calling for sanctions against Azerbaijan

The European Parliament has adopted a resolution calling on
the EU to impose sanctions against Azerbaijan in connection with the recent
Azerbaijani offensive against Artsakh. The members of the European Parliament
(MEP) also call on the EU to reduce its dependency on Azerbaijani gas imports.

 

The resolution, however, has no binding force.

 

Four hundred and ninety-one MEPs voted in favor, nine
opposed, and 36 abstained.

“The European Parliament urges the High Representative and
the EEAS to suspend the negotiations for a renewed partnership agreement until
Azerbaijan has demonstrated its genuine readiness to respect the rights and
security concerns of the Armenian population of Nagorno-Karabakh,” reads the
text of the resolution.

The MEPs underlined the need to reduce the EU’s dependency
on Azerbaijani gas imports and called for the suspension of all imports of oil
and gas from Azerbaijan to the EU if the relations between Armenia and
Azerbaijan deteriorate.
